<p><strong>Sally Says:</strong> This is my first time reading a book by Sawyer. I&#8217;ve known about her for a number of years, having &#8220;watched&#8221; her receive her first contract and many others on my writers&#8217; email loop.  I&#8217;d heard that Janette Oke endorsed her first book, and I would say that&#8217;s a good author comparison.</p>
<p><em>Fields of Grace</em> is the story of Lillian, an immigrant whose husband dies en route to America. Her husband&#8217;s close friend Eli, a single man who&#8217;s never married, is traveling with them, and to keep things looking proper and to provide for his friend&#8217;s wife and sons, Eli offers to marry Lillian. It&#8217;s a very believable marriage-of-convenience story.</p>
<p>The book is not fast moving, but it&#8217;s by no means boring. It did start a little slow for my tastes; but after a few chapters things began to pick up, and I was eager to see how the relationship between Lillian and Eli would develop. Readers who loves historical fiction or a tender romance will find <em>Fields of Grace</em> an enjoyable, relaxing read.</p>
